A pair of youngsters's sneakers The term "sneaker" is frequently attributed to American Henry Nelson McKinney, who was an promoting agent for N. W. Ayer & Son. In 1917, he utilised the phrase because the rubber sole made the shoe's wearer stealthy. The phrase was currently in use a minimum of as early as 1887, when the Boston Journal built reference to "sneakers" as "the identify boys give to tennis footwear." The name "sneakers" at first referred to how silent the rubber soles ended up on the ground, in distinction to noisy typical challenging leather sole costume sneakers. Another person donning sneakers could "sneak up", whilst someone putting on specifications couldn't.

British organization J.W. Foster and Sons designed and generated the initial sneakers created for jogging in 1895; the shoes were being spiked to allow for bigger traction and pace. The corporation marketed its high-excellent handmade operating sneakers to athletes around the globe, inevitably getting a deal for that manufacture of operating footwear with the British crew in the 1924 Summer season Olympics.

This kind of footwear also became popular in the usa with the flip of the twentieth century, in which they were termed 'sneakers'. In 1892, the U.S. Rubber Corporation launched the very first rubber-soled sneakers while in the nation, sparking a surge in demand from customers and creation.
Athletic shoes were significantly employed for leisure and outdoor activities within the switch in the twentieth century - plimsolls ended up even identified Using the unwell-fated Scott Antarctic expedition of 1911. Plimsolls have been commonly worn by pupils in educational facilities' Bodily education and learning lessons in britain from your fifties right up until the early 1970s.[citation essential]
Plimsolls ended up greatly worn by vacationers and also started to be worn by sportsmen on the tennis and croquet courts for their comfort. Unique soles with engraved patterns to boost the surface area grip from the shoe had been produced, and these have been requested in bulk for the use of the British Military.
